I am working to make my application apple scriptable,for which i use the developer material in the link here

That tutorial take CircleView Application for example, and make it into an apple Scriptable application through some procedural steps.

While following that steps,after a new run script has been added in CircleView Application as said in the tutorial , i got error

Developer/Tools/sdp: No such file or directory

I don’t know how to solve

    I had an error that was complaining there was no /usr/bin/sdp

    I found the file in /Applications/Xcode.app/Contents/Developer/usr/bin/sdp and fixed the error with:

    cd /usr/bin
    sudo ln -s "/Applications/Xcode.app/Contents/Developer/usr/bin/sdp"
    

    Which created a symlink to where sdp was installed. I installed Xcode via the AppStore and so I’m not sure why this file / symlink was not created in the first place, but this fixed my problems.
